无法登录新创建的用户帐户

无法登录新创建的用户帐户

System Settings我从>创建了一个新的用户帐户User Accounts

我可以从终端登录到新用户帐户,但无法从 GUI 登录到用户帐户。

当我尝试从 GUI 登录到新创建的用户帐户时,它没有显示任何错误并返回到登录窗口。(当我输入错误的密码时,它会显示密码错误,但当我输入正确的密码时,它只是返回到登录窗口而没有任何消息。)

我正在使用 Ubuntu 14.04.4 LTS

答案1

似乎该帐户已被禁用。打开系统设置,选择帐户,解锁更改。查看“密码”旁边的内容,如果显示“帐户已禁用”,请单击该选项并选择一个选项。如果这不起作用,则这是一个我不知道如何解决的问题。我使用的是 15.10,我的所有登录都失效了。在这种情况下,备份您的计算机,从另一台计算机获取 Live CD 或 USB,然后重新安装 Ubuntu。我不得不这么做。我希望这是第一次。

答案2

当我通过命令行或 GUI 创建新用户时,遇到了同样的问题。一切看起来都像是创建时没有任何错误,但当我尝试登录时,它会闪烁一秒钟加载桌面,然后跳回登录屏幕。

看起来,useradd 和 GUI-Users 都无法创建用户主文件夹 '/home/$USER',所以我复制了另一个用户文件夹:

cd /home
sudo cp -R bob $USER

将 bob 替换为好用户文件夹的名称,将 $USER 替换为新用户的帐户名。然后,您必须设置新文件夹的权限。

sudo chown -R $USER:$USER $USER

再次用新用户的帐户名替换 $USER。因此,如果新帐户名是 rsmith,则它将如下所示。

sudo chown -R rsmith:rsmith rsmith

这解决了我的问题并允许我最终以新用户身份登录。

答案3

也许您的主目录的权限设置为 root,这就是它返回登录窗口的原因。不久前我也遇到过同样的问题,我可以登录,但几秒后,它又回到了登录窗口。

尝试使用您的终端更改您的主目录:

sudo chown -R $USER:$USER /home/user_name

相关内容